A galactose-specific sugar:phosphotransferase permease is prevalent in the non-core genome of Streptococcus mutans
Three genes predicted to encode the A, B and C domains of a sugar:phosphotransferase system (PTS) permease specific for galactose (EII(Gal)) were identified in the genomes of 35 of 57 recently-sequenced isolates of Streptococcus mutans, the primary etiological agent of human dental caries.
